Common misconception: TUV certificates based on IEC 61215 and IEC 61730 standards don't include IP68 waterproof testing. Discover what's actually covered and when separate IP testing is required. Bottom Line Up Front: Most conventional solar panels come with IP65-IP67 ratings, which provide excellent protection for typical installations.
Key Reality: Most solar panels have an IP rating only for the junction box, not the entire solar module. The solar cells themselves are protected by tempered glass, which naturally shields against liquid and solid ingress. Junction boxes represent the primary entry point for:
